OBJECTIVES: The purpose of this study to determine the clinical pattern and prevalence of heart disease in pregnancy at the first established cardio-maternal unit in Iraq over the last 4 years; since January 2015 till May 2019. Data are presented as number and percentage.Entities:

Clinical pattern and prevalence of heart disease in pregnancy at cardio-maternal clinic
| Main diagnosis | Total no. (%) | Subtypes | Subtypes no. (%) |
|---|---|---|---|
| VHD | 86 (34.1%) | PHV | 23 (26.7%) |
| MS | 22 (25.6%) | ||
| MR | 18 (20.9%) | ||
| PS | 11 (12.8%) | ||
| AR | 8 (9.3%) | ||
| AS | 4 (4.7%) | ||
| CHD | 77 (30.5%) | ASD | 27 (35%) |
| VSD | 27 (35%) | ||
| TOF | 8 (10.4%) | ||
| Miscellaneous | 8 (10.4%) | ||
| PDA | 7 (9%) | ||
| CMP | 75 (29.8%) | PPCM | 57 (76%) |
| DCM | 11 (14.7%) | ||
| HOCM | 4 (5.3%) | ||
| Non-compaction | 3 (4%) | ||
| PHT | 10 (4%) | ||
| IHD | 4 (1.6%) | ||
| 252 (100%) |
AR aortic regurgitation, AS aortic stenosis, ASD atrial septal defect, CHD congenital heart disease, CMP cardiomyopathy, DCM dilated cardiomyopathy, HOCM hypertrophic cardiomyopathy, IHD ischemic heart disease, MR mitral regurgitation, MS mitral stenosis, PDA patent ductus artriosus, PHT pulmonary hypertension, PHV prosthetic heart valve, PPCM peripartum cardiomyopathy, PS pulmonary stenosis, TOF tetralogy of Fallot, VHD valvular heart disease, VSD ventricular septal defect
